What is Therapeutic Recreation?

Therapeutic Recreation, also known as Recreational Therapy, uses recreation and leisure activities to help people with disabilities improve their skills, abilities, overall health, and well-being. 

Recreational Therapy provides inclusive recreational opportunities and goal oriented treatment for individuals with disabilities to improve their health and overall quality of life through the process of thoughtful and careful intervention so they may overcome barriers, learn, adapt and grow.
